Understanding Your Options: From a Used Subaru Impreza Engine to a Reconditioned Power Unit

When your Impreza’s engine fails, understanding the different types of available units is your first crucial step. The market primarily offers four tiers: a simple used Subaru Impreza engine removed from a salvage vehicle, a reconditioned Subaru Impreza engine that’s been cleaned and tested with worn parts replaced, a rebuilt Subaru Impreza engine which involves a more thorough teardown and rebuild to specific tolerances, and a remanufactured Subaru Impreza engine which is brought back to original factory specifications, often with a warranty mirroring a new unit. Your choice directly impacts reliability, longevity, and the final cost of reconditioned engine or used motor.


From my experience in the trade, a low-mileage used engine for sale can be a lottery. While initial engine price is low, you inherit its unknown history. For a daily driver, a reputable reconditioned engine price often represents better value, offering a known baseline of quality. The core question is whether you’re looking for a quick, cheap fix or a long-term solution. Knowing the technical difference between these units helps you ask the right questions when you start to find used engines and prevents you from overpaying for a basic unit marketed as a fully rebuilt one.

The Real Price of Power: Analysing Reconditioned Engine Prices and Used Motor Costs in the UK

Let’s cut through the listings and talk real numbers. As of late, a used Subaru Impreza engine for a common non-turbo model can range from £400 to £1,200, purely as an engine for sale in UK. However, this is just the starting point. A reconditioned Subaru Impreza engine from a specialist will typically range from £1,500 to over £3,000 for performance turbo models, reflecting the parts and labour invested. While searching for a replacement engine supplier near me, you’ll find that a clear reconditioned engines price list is a sign of a transparent supplier.

It’s vital to understand what drives these costs. A genuine remanufactured Subaru Impreza engine commands a premium because it often includes new pistons, bearings, seals, and machining work. Many owners are surprised to find that the engine price for a quality recon unit can sometimes approach the value of an older Impreza. This is where you must weigh the car’s sentimental or performance value against the outlay. Always request a detailed breakdown; a trustworthy replacement engine supplier near me should explain the cost of reconditioned engine components, not just give a single figure.

Beyond the Purchase: The Critical Details of Engine Supply and Fitting

Finding the best place to buy engines is only half the battle. The phrase Subaru Impreza engine supplied and fitted encompasses a significant portion of your total bill. Engine supply and fitting is a skilled job, particularly on all-wheel-drive Subarus which require careful alignment of the drivetrain. A typical engine supply and fit near me quote for an Impreza can range from £500 to £1,000+ in labour, depending on the workshop’s rates and complexity (turbo models, automatic transmissions, etc.).

Many enthusiasts learn the hard way that a cheap 2nd hand engine can become very expensive once fitting complications arise. A professional installation includes not just the physical swap but also fresh fluids, belts, a new clutch if needed, and addressing any ancillary issues found during disassembly. When evaluating engine supply and fit near me services, always ask what’s included. Does the quote cover disposal of the old unit, new gaskets, and coolant? A clear, inclusive quote from a workshop experienced in engine replacement UK procedures builds far more trust than a suspiciously low hourly rate.

The Hidden Expenses: What "Engine for Sale" Ads Don't Tell You

The advertised engine price is a mirage if you don’t budget for the hidden extras. These are the honest lessons that define a realistic budget. Firstly, a used Subaru engine may not come with all necessary ancillaries. You might need to swap over your alternator, power steering pump, or intake manifold, which if worn, should be refurbished. Secondly, consider the "while you’re in there" items. This is the perfect time to replace the timing belt, water pump, and thermostat on any replacement engine, adding several hundred pounds in parts.

Furthermore, post-installation issues are common with second hand Subaru Impreza engine units. Oil leaks from disturbed fittings, faulty sensors, or a struggling clutch that finally fails with the new engine’s power can all appear. I’ve seen many used engine sale projects where the final cost ballooned by 30-40% due to these unforeseen issues. Budgeting at least 10-15% of the total engine supply and fitting quote for contingencies is a practice borne from real-world experience and prevents financial surprise.

Making the Final Decision: Evaluating Total Cost vs. Value for Your Impreza

Ultimately, deciding between a used motor engines purchase or a reconditioned engines investment comes down to a total cost-benefit analysis. Ask yourself: Is this a cherished, long-term vehicle or a temporary runabout? For a beloved project or a performance model, investing in a remanufactured Subaru Impreza engine from a specialist is rarely regretted. It transforms the car for another 100,000 miles. For an older, high-mileage daily, a sensibly sourced used engine for sale with a reputable engine supply and fit near me service might be the most economical path.

To build true authority on the subject, you must look at the complete picture. Get three itemised quotes that include the reconditioned engine prices (or used unit cost), all parts, labour, VAT, and warranty terms.
